Audiolab 8000AP – Pre-Amplifier
High End Digital Audio Processor with HDMI
IAG are proud to announce the launch of the new generation Pre amplifier – 8000AP from
Audiolab. The new HDMI enabled 8000 series ‘Audio Processor’ is a reference quality 7channel audio processor and preamplifier.

“An Audiophile approach to home cinema”

The Audiolab 8000AP offers superb quality audio processing and switching with capacity
for stereo and multi-channel analogue sources, co-axial and optical digital inputs and twin
HDMI inputs. Multi-channel HD audio can be passed via the HDMI connections from
appropriately equipped source components.
The emphasis is on high-quality audio offering an unequalled sound quality whatever
source is used. The Audiolab 8000AP Audio processor features the latest in Digital signal
processing; A dual core Cirrus Logic™ DSP with a 24bit front end and 32bit post
processor. ‘High End’ Digital to Analogue conversion is handled by 24bit/192KHz bitstream D/A converters with differential outputs, followed by phase linear active filters and
ultra low distortion analogue volume controls.

Audiolab 8000AP – Pre-Amplifier

1.

HDMI circuit.
The HDMI is a discrete section included as standard, which features 2 x HDMI inputs – fully HDMI1.2
compliant and certified to HDMI 1.3 - and a single output. The audio streams are read from the HDMI
data and passed to the DSP section of the processor for subsequent decoding and D/A conversion.
Both inputs and the outputs are fully HDCP compliant and are capable of all video resolutions up to
and including 1080P. The HDMI signal sent to the display is an exact replica of the signal fed into the
machine.

2.

8 Channel analogue volume control
A high quality digitally addressed, analogue volume control is applied at the end of the output stage.
This volume section is either fed from the post DAC active filters, or directly from the 5.1 bypass
inputs if these are used. In the event that the 5.1 bypass inputs are used, the signal purity is fully
retained with a direct path, bypassing all processing circuitry.

3.

Analogue input circuits
The 8000AP has provision for up to six line level analogue inputs and a 5.1 bypass input - which
connects directly to the analogue volume control (2). All standard analogue inputs can be fed into the
DSP and encoded by a variety of processing modes including Dolby Pro Logic II, Dolby Pro Logic IIx
and all versions of DTS NEO:6.

4.

Power supply
A high quality ‘torroidal’ transformer, linear power supply is used for the 8000AP. The PCB design
ensures that there is minimum electromagnetic interaction with any sensitive components. A series of
quick-blow fuses protect the circuit from high in-rush currents or power spikes.

5.

The OSD (On Screen Display)
The OSD section allows full control of all menu functions of the 8000AP. A separate composite output
carries this menu, allowing configuration of inputs, speaker sizes and distances, HDMI decoding
options, and bass management. In addition to the OSD menu, the remote control acceses a
‘Quickset’ menu which allows the user quick and easy calibration of all essential functions.

3

Audiolab 8000AP – Pre-Amplifier
6.

Post DAC Phase Linear active filters.
Phase linear active filters are utilised after the D-A conversion, using components chosen for their
excellent sonic characteristics. This moves DAC noise outside the audible spectrum, lowering the
noise floor significantly and optimises the analogue output prior to amplification.

8.

Microprocessor
A powerful microprocessor ensures all the component parts of the 8000AP work together seamlessly.

9.

DSP
The 8000AP uses a "Dual" DSP which integrates a multi-channel audio decoder and a 32-bit audio
processor with an audio optimised software framework. This allows the 8000AP to decode all of the
popular processing modes listed below.
